The Role                                                                                                                  

This role leads the regional M&A Transactional Risks business, driving growth in line with firm strategy. Key responsibilities include overseeing the pipeline, strengthening client and market relationships, and ensuring high‑quality delivery of W&I, Tax, and Contingent Risk solutions.

 

Key Responsibilities

Strategic Leadership & Growth

  • Lead the regional M&A business and refine the Transactional Risks value proposition.
  • Drive revenue growth and market expansion across W&I, Tax, and Contingent Risks.
  • Ensure targets are met in an ethical and compliant manner.

 

Sales, Pipeline & Execution

  • Manage the regional pipeline and partner with Broking Leaders on prioritization and execution.
  • Maintain high standards of advisory and placement within tight timelines.
  • Maximize revenue from new and existing clients.

 

Collaboration & Cross‑Functional Engagement

  • Build a collaborative culture across regional and global M&A teams.
  • Work with CoEs, other LoBs, and global offices to support cross‑selling and innovation.
  • Contribute to M&A initiatives and global best practices.

 

Operational & Organizational Management

  • Provide financial and operational oversight in line with Group standards.
  • Deliver regular reporting and insights for leadership.

 

Client & Market Relationships

  • Understand client structures and needs, and engage key decision makers.
  • Build strong relationships with insurers and underwriters, particularly in London.

 

Major Accountabilities

  • Develop and align mid‑ and long‑term M&A strategy.
  • Deliver high‑quality advice and tailored insurance solutions.
  • Drive collaborative business development across teams and regions.
  • Support product innovation, cross‑selling, and organizational initiatives.
  • Provide timely reporting and governance support.
  • Strengthen client and insurer relationships to enhance placement outcomes.
